Greece - Renewables and Biofuels Final Consumption in Non-Metallic Minerals Sector

Since 2014, Greece Renewables and Biofuels Final Consumption in Non-Metallic Minerals Sector decreased by 21.5% year on year. In 2019, the country was number 19 among other countries in Renewables and Biofuels Final Consumption in Non-Metallic Minerals Sector with 88.25 Gigawatthours. Greece is overtaken by Lithuania, which was number 18 with 124.72 Gigawatthours and is followed by Luxembourg with 62.66 Gigawatthours. Germany ranked the highest with 6,145.37 Gigawatthours in 2019, that is an increase of 5.6% versus 2018. Spain, United Kingdom and France resp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Estonia recorded the best 5 years average growth at +128.1% per year, while Ukraine was the worst growing country at -58.7% per year.
